Malocclusion is very closely related to the disharmony of mesiodistaltooth-width with dental arches. It is important to know the mesiodistaltooth widths before establishing the diagnosis and planning oforthodontic treatment. The ultimate goal of orthodontic treatment isfacialesthetic, which is supported by a balanced soft tissue profile. The aim ofthis cross sectional study was to investigate the correlation betweenmesiodistal tooth widths with the convexity of soft tissue profile. Theresult of the study can be used as a reference and guidance inestablishing orthodontic diagnosis and treatment planning. The numberof sample was 50 (18 males and 32 females), aged 18-27 years old.Criteria for sample selection comprised absence of interproximalcaries/filling, no tooth deformity, aged over 17 years, never undergoorthodontic treatment, the presence of teeth from the right first molarthrough the left first molar, both upper and lower, Buginese orMakassarese people, and Class I Angle malocclusion. Tooth sizemeasurements were performed on study models by using slidingcaliper. The photo of each subject was taken cephalometrically. Theangular measurement was performed on cephalogram, using Subtelny'sanalysis. The soft tissue convexity degree was represented by N-SnPog.The data was processed using SPSS program and tested byindependent t-test and correlation. It can be concluded that the meanvalue of mesiodistal width on males was greater that those on females(p<0.05), the mean of facial convexity degree on males (159.05°) wassmaller than those on females (162.77°), which was different significantly (p<0.05), and there was a very weak correlation (r<0.25) oralmost no correlation between mesiodistal tooth-width and the degree ofsoft tissue facial profile, and it was not significant statistically (p>0.05).

Background The right atrial longitudinal strain (RALS) has been shown to be a useful parameter to define right atrial (RA) subclinical dysfunction in several cardiovascular disorders prior to changes in traditional RA two dimensional and volumetric parameters. There is a scarcity of data regarding normal values for RALS in a normal African population. Objectives We sought to establish normal values for RALS and its correlation with age, in a Sub-Saharan black African population. Methods This was a retrospective cross-sectional study of 100 normal individuals (recruited as controls for another study) performed at Chris Hani Baragwanath Hospital (2017-2019). All echocardiographic measurements were done as per standard guidelines. RALS was measured using Philips QLAB 9 (Amsterdam, The Netherlands) speckle-tracking software. Results Median age was 37.5 years (IQR 26- 46, 60% females). The mean right atrial volume indexed to body surface area (RAVI) was 19.5 ± 5.7 mL/m and the mean RALS was 32.7 ± 10.5%. There was a trend towards decreasing RALS with age (r=-0.15, P=0.129) with no change in RAVI with age ( P=0.27). Males had a tendency towards higher RAVI and RALS measurements compared to females (20.8 ± 6.3 mL/m and 18.7 ± 5.2 mL/m , P=0.07: 34.6 ± 9.6% and 31.4 ± 10.9 %, P=0.141, respectively) . BMI was an independent predictor of RALS on multivariate analysis ( r= -0.43, P =0.003) Conclusion We have defined the normal reference values for RALS in a black population. RALS tended to decrease with age prior to change in RAVI and can serve as a marker of subclinical RA dysfunction . BMI was an important determinant of RALS.

Abstract Background Few studies have focused on patient-related factors in analyzing long-term functional outcome and health-related quality of life (HRQoL) in patients with postoperative lower extremity soft tissue sarcoma (STS). Objective The purpose of this study was to investigate factors associated with postoperative functional outcome and HRQoL in patients with lower extremity STS. Methods This cross-sectional study was performed in a tertiary referral center using the Toronto Extremity Salvage Score (TESS), Quality-of-Life Questionnaire (QLQ)-C30 and 15 Dimension (15D) measures. Functional outcome and HRQoL data were collected prospectively. All patients were treated by a multidisciplinary team according to a written treatment protocol. Results A total of 141 patients who had undergone limb-salvage surgery were included. Depending on the outcome measure used, 19–51% of patients were completely asymptomatic and 13–14% of patients had an unimpaired HRQoL. The mean score for TESS, 15D mobility score, and QLQ-C30 Physical Functioning scale were 86, 0.83, and 75, respectively, while the mean score for 15D was 0.88, and 73 for QLQ-C30 QoL. Lower functional outcome was statistically significantly associated with higher age, higher body mass index (BMI), and the need for reconstructive surgery and radiotherapy, while lower HRQoL was statistically significantly associated with higher age, higher BMI, and reconstructive surgery. Conclusion Functional outcome and HRQoL were generally high in this cross-sectional study of patients with STS in the lower extremity. Both tumor- and treatment-related factors had an impact but patient-related factors such as age and BMI were the major determinants of both functional outcome and HRQoL.

Abstract Background Medico-legal or forensic autopsy is a special type of autopsy performed under the orders of a legal authority in circumstances involving unnatural, suspicious or criminal deaths. Gross and histopathological studies of viscera in medico-legal autopsies have been observed to serve as crucial tool in the detection of undiagnosed disease conditions and the resulting findings may closely represent the general population. Methods A prospective cross sectional study was carried out at the Muhimbili National Hospital (MNH) department of pathology, to medico-legal autopsies received at the MNH mortuary. The study included 103 cases in an eight month period. Both lungs were weighed for each case and tissue samples were collected from each lobe, in both lungs. Other gross findings were observed and recorded. Tissue sections were made and stained with hematoxylin and eosin and evaluated under a microscope. Results Out of 103 cases studied, 88.3% were male with mean age of 35.8 + 16.6 years. In females, the mean age was 31.6 + 10.4 years. The mean weight of lungs was found to be 627.3 + 138.5g and 591.7 + 129.7g for the right and left lung, respectively, in males. In females, the mean weight of lungs was 616.7 + 166.1g and 583.3 + 155.8g for the right and left lung, respectively. More than half (53.4%) of lung samples had some pathological disease, and the leading diagnosis was pulmonary congestion/oedema (22.3%) followed by lobar pneumonia (18.5%). Age was found to relate with the observed histological diagnosis of the lungs. Conclusion Males, especially the youth and adults are the main victims of medico-legal deaths. The study also revealed high prevalence of undiagnosed lung diseases in victims of medico-legal deaths. These findings may reflect heavy burden of lung diseases in the general population.

Objective: To evaluate the relationship between inner canthal distance and maxillary anterior teeth width withrespect to age, gender and ethnicity. Study Design: Cross sectional study. Place and Duration of Study: Altamash Institute of Dental Medicine, Karachi, from Aug 2019 to Jan 2020. Methodology: One hundred participants from both genders with full permanent dentition, no interdental space or pathology and facial symmetry were included in this study. The measurements were carried out with digital Vernier caliper. SPSS-25 was used for statistical analysis. Results: The mean ± SD of inner canthal distance and width of maxillary anterior teeth were 2.99cm ± 0.46and 3.82cm ± 0.35 respectively. A significant difference was found between gender (p=0.037) and inner canthaldistance. The maxillary anterior teeth width and inner canthal distance varies amongst different ethnicities(p=0.01). The inner canthal distance does not vary with advancing age (p=0.87) whereas width of maxillaryanterior teeth varies (p=0.04). A weak correlation value of 0.47 was found between inner canthal distance andmaxillary anterior teeth width. Conclusion: This research suggests that there is a weak relationship between inner canthal distance and maxillary anterior teeth width. Therefore, a multiplication ratio of 1.27 is advised to get combined mesiodistal width of maxillary anterior teeth. Additionally, the value of both differs in various local ethnicities. Inner canthal distance does not vary with age though has significant gender disparities while maxillary anterior teeth width remains constant.

Abstract Background Infancy is the of a child’s visual development. Refractive errors, especially myopia, are a common vision disorder. Thus, the purpose of this study was to explore refractive errors and risk factors for myopia among infants aged 1–18 months in Tianjin, China. Methods A total of 583 infants aged 1–18 months participated in this cross-sectional study at Tianjin Women’s and Children’s Health Center in China from February 2019 to November 2020. Each infant received a complete ophthalmologic examination, and myopia-related risk factors were investigated using a questionnaire. Results A total of 583 eligible infants participated in this study, including 312 (53.5%) boys and 271 (46.5%) girls. There were 164 (28.1%) premature born infants. The mean age was 6.59 ± 4.84 months (range, 1–18 months). The mean spherical equivalent (MSE) for the right eye was 1.81 D ± 1.56 D, with no difference related to sex (P = 0.104). Refractive state showed an average hyperopia of +2.74 ± 1.74 D at early ages, followed by a trend toward less hyperopia, finally reaching +1.35 ± 1.44 D at the age of 18 months (P ≤0.001). The overall prevalence rates of myopia (MSE ≤ −0.50 D), emmetropia (−0.50 D<MSE<+0.50 D), hyperopia (MSE ≥ +2.00 D), and astigmatism (≥ 1.50 D) were 5.1%, 10.8%, 42.7%, and 49.9%, respectively. The chi-square tests showed that gender, gestational age ≥37 weeks, winter birth, prenatal exposure to environmental tobacco smoke, and parental history of high myopia were associated with children’s myopia (P = 0.022, P = 0.023, P = 0.038, P = 0.015, P<0.001, respectively). Conclusions Among Chinese infants in Tianjin, hyperopia and astigmatism were the most frequent refractive errors, and the diopter was lower in individuals with higher age. In a small number of infants with myopia, genetic factors and the prenatal environment were associated with the early onset of myopia.

ABSTRACT Objective: The present study is intended to add a new parameter that would be useful in orthodontic clinical evaluation, treatment planning, and determination of vertical dimension (at occlusion). Materials and Methods: Standardized videographic recording of 79 subjects during posed smile was captured. Each video was then cut into 30 photos using the free studio software. The widest commissure-to-commissure posed smile frame (posed smile width [SW]) was selected as one of 10 or more frames showing an identical smile. Lower third of the face is measured from subnasale to soft tissue menton using a digital vernier caliper. Two values were then compared. Ratio between lower facial height and posed SW was calculated. Results: The co-relation between smiling width and lower facial height was found to be statistically significant (P < 0.01). The ratio of lower facial height and smiling width was calculated as 1.0016 with a standard deviation (SD) = 0.04 in males and 1.0301 with an SD = 0.07 in females. The difference between the mean lower facial height in males and females was statistically significant with a t = 10.231 and P = 0.000. The difference between the mean smiling width in males and females was also statistically significant with a t = 5.653 and P = 0.000. Conclusion: In class I subjects with pleasing appearance, normal facial proportions, normal overjet and overbite, and average Frankfort mandibular angle, the lower facial height (subnasale to soft tissue menton) is equal to posed SW.

Objectives: We aim to investigate the involvement of the choroid and retinal nerve fiber layer (RNFL) in COVID-19 patients using spectral domain optical coherence tomography. Methods: This cross-sectional study was conducted between April and June 2020. 40 patients (23 female and 17 male) with COVID-19 and 42 healthy individuals (26 female and 16 male) were included in the study. The OCT scans were performed 4 weeks after the COVID-19 diagnosis. Results: In the COVID-19 group, in the right eyes, the mean nasal choroidal thickness was 295.70 ± 7,046 μm ( p = 0.017), mean subfoveal choroidal thickness was 333.25 ± 6,353 μm ( p = 0.003), mean temporal choroidal thickness was 296.63 ± 6,324 μm ( p = 0.039), and mean RNFL was 89.23 ± 1.30 μm ( p = 0.227). In the left eyes, mean nasal choroidal thickness was 287.88 ± 9,033 μm ( p = 0.267), mean subfoveal choroidal thickness was 333.80 ± 9,457 μm ( p = 0.013), mean temporal choroidal thickness was 298.50 ± 9,158 μm ( p = 0.079), and mean RNFL was 89.48 ± 1,289 μm ( p = 0.092). Compared with the control group, the patient group had significant thickening of the choroidal thickness in all quadrants of the right eyes, and significant thickening of the subfoveal choroidal thickness in the left eyes. There was no significant difference in the RNFL thickness between groups ( p > 0.05). Conclusion: COVID-19 may cause a subclinical involvement in the choroidal layer.
